How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cheshire?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heshire Studio Apartments | $1,263 | $1,025 | $1,325 |
| Cheshire 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,435 | $1,015 | $2,607 |
| Cheshire 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,787 | $1,150 | $3,023 |
| Cheshire 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,875 | $740 | $3,281 |
| Cheshire 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,106 | $640 | $3,948 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heshire
How much are Studio apartments in Cheshire?
There are currently 15 Studio Apartments in Cheshire with rent ranges from $1,025 to $1,325 with an average price of $1,263.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cheshire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cheshire ranges from $1,015 to $2,607 with an average monthly rent of $1,435.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cheshire c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cheshire range from $1,150 to $3,023.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,787.
How expensive are Cheshire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 20 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Cheshire on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$740 to $3,281 - averaging $1,875 for the location.
